How they compare
Morocco currently reports 1.63 billion against 1.52 billion in Dominican Republic, a difference of 108.00 million.
That makes Morocco's figure about 1.1 times Dominican Republic's.
The two have swapped places 10 times across 30 shared years of data; in 1996 it was Morocco ahead.
Dominican Republic ranks 69th and Morocco ranks 67th of 153 countries.
Dominican Republic has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

About this data
The data are derived from the Bank for International Settlements (BIS) International Debt Securities Statistics and cover securities with original maturity of up to 12 months.
